Strongs Number: H5074
- Hebrew Word
- נָדַד
- Transliteration
- nâdad
- Phonetic
- naw-dad'
- Part of Speech
- Verb
- Strongs Definition
-
properly to wave to and fro (rarely to flap up and down); figuratively to {rove} {flee } or (causatively) to drive away
- BDB Definition
-
1. to retreat, flee, depart, move, wander abroad, stray, flutter
a. (Qal)
1. to retreat, flee
2. to flee, depart
3. to wander, stray
4. to flutter (of birds)
b. (Poal) to flee away, be chased
c. (Hiphil) to chase away
d. (Hophal) to be chased away
e. (Hithpolel) to flee away
- Origin
- A primitive root
- Bible Usage
- chase ({away}) X-(idiom) could {not} {depart} flee (X {apace} {away}) (re-) {move} thrust {away} wander ({abroad} {-er} -ing).
